Blackfeet Community College

Blackfeet Community College today has a student population of about 2,200 students. The Blackfeet Community College is a non-profit tribal college. They provide their students with opportunities to demonstrate their self-sufficiency in an environment that also uplifts their cultural heritage.

Woodland Community College

Woodland Community College is a Hispanic Serving Institution and was established in 1975. They aim to provide an open and inclusive learning environment for their students in order to promote success for all.

Whittier College

Whittier College is a private, liberal arts college as well as a designated Hispanic Serving Institution, established in 1887. Whittier College is nationally recognized for its acceptance rate into graduate schools for the life sciences.
